This bit is set by hardware when the AWU module generates an interrupt and
cleared by software on reading AWUCSR. Writing to this bit does not change its
value.
0: No AWU interrupt occurred
1: AWU interrupt occurred
This bit enables the AWU RC oscillator and connects its output to the input capture
of the 8-bit Lite timer. This allows the timer to be used to measure the AWU RC
oscillator dispersion and then compensate this dispersion by providing the right
value in the AWUPRE register.
0: Measurement disabled
1: Measurement enabled
This bit enables the Auto-wakeup From Halt feature: once Halt mode is entered, the
AWUFH wakes up the microcontroller after a time delay dependent on the AWU
prescaler value. It is set and cleared by software.
0: AWUFH (Auto-wakeup From Halt) mode disabled
1: AWUFH (Auto-wakeup From Halt) mode enabled
